The bachelor's program at SFSU was ranked #5 on College Factual's Best Schools for labor studies list. It is also ranked #2 in California.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, San Francisco State University handed out 12 bachelor's degrees in labor studies. This is a decrease of 8% over the previous year when 13 degrees were handed out.

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the labor studies majors at San Francisco State University.
For the most recent academic year available, 50% of labor studies bachelor's degrees went to men and 50% went to women.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from San Francisco State University with a bachelor's in labor studies.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 6 |
Black or African American | 0 |
Hispanic or Latino | 3 |
White | 2 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 1 |
Other Races | 0 |
